How to Review a Hagerstown Estimate
Use these checks when comparing HVAC contractors serving Hagerstown. They are designed to make each estimate more specific, easier to verify, and less dependent on generic averages.
- Verify refrigerant type and parts availability on older systems.
- Confirm whether ductwork, thermostat wiring, drain lines, and permits are included.
- Ask how emergency diagnostic fees change outside normal business hours.
- Ask whether the estimate includes a load calculation for replacements.
- Ask for the estimate, warranty, exclusions, and scheduling assumptions in writing.

| Estimate item | Why it matters | Question to ask |
|---|---|---|
| Labor warranty | Manufacturer parts coverage is different from contractor labor coverage. | How long is labor covered, and what maintenance is required? |
| Duct and airflow | Duct restrictions, returns, filters, and static pressure can affect comfort after the repair. | Did the quote include airflow checks and ductwork assumptions? |
| Refrigerant and parts | Older systems can be more expensive to repair when refrigerant or boards are limited. | What refrigerant type and key parts are required? |
| Load calculation | Replacement equipment should be sized to the home, not only matched to the old unit. | Will the estimate include a Manual J or documented load calculation? |
When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Hagerstown
Call sooner when you see
- Refrigerant-line icing, major water overflow, or a system that repeatedly shuts down.
- Carbon monoxide alarm, combustion concern, or blocked venting.
- Burning smell, electrical arcing, repeated breaker trips, or water near electrical components.
Plan ahead for
- Duct, thermostat, or zoning upgrades when comfort problems are recurring.
- Maintenance before the first heavy heating or cooling period.
- Replacement planning for older systems before peak-season demand.

Seasonal HVAC Needs in Hagerstown
Proper seasonal maintenance keeps your Hagerstown HVAC running efficiently:
- Fall: Schedule furnace inspection before heating season
- Winter: Change filters monthly during heavy heating use
- Spring: Have AC serviced before summer arrives
- Summer: Keep outdoor units clear of debris

How long does an HVAC system last in Hagerstown?
In Hagerstown, air conditioners typically last 15-20 years and furnaces last 15-25 years with proper maintenance. Heavy heating use in Indiana can shorten furnace lifespan if not properly maintained.
Can HVAC cause allergy problems in Hagerstown?
Yes, dirty HVAC systems can circulate allergens. Regular filter changes, duct cleaning, and maintenance help improve indoor air quality in Hagerstown homes.
Why is my AC not cooling properly in Hagerstown?
Common causes include low refrigerant, dirty filters, thermostat issues, or an undersized system. Hagerstown summers can also strain older units. A technician can diagnose the issue.
What is the best time to replace HVAC in Hagerstown?
Spring and fall are ideal for HVAC replacement in Hagerstown—demand is lower and you avoid emergency installation during extreme weather.
What causes high energy bills with HVAC in Hagerstown?
High Hagerstown energy bills can result from poor insulation, aging equipment, dirty filters, duct leaks, or incorrect thermostat settings. An energy audit can identify issues.
What is a heat pump and is it good for Hagerstown?
Heat pumps provide both heating and cooling using electricity. They work well in Hagerstown because modern cold-climate heat pumps now work well even in Indiana's winters. Modern units work effectively even in extreme temperatures.
